- ベストアンサー
Cookieのメリット
最近Cookieの許可・不許可をサイト別に分けるようブラウザの設定を変更したのですが、Cookieの要求が多くて驚いています。 そこで 1.ID・パスワードなど情報の保存、訪問回数の保存、トラッキングの他にCookieができる事。 2.IDの保存が必要なサイト以外でCookieの拒否を行った場合のデメリット。 3.複数回Cookieの保存を要求してくる場合があるのは何故か。 以上3点について教えて欲しいと思い質問しました。 3点すべてでなくても構わないので、答えていただけると幸いです。 よろしくおねがいします。
- みんなの回答 (2)
- 専門家の回答
質問者が選んだベストアンサー
1. 訪問回数だけではなく、例えばショッピングカートの中身等の保存も可能です。ビジターがそのサイトで何らかのアクションを起こした情報は取る事ができますので、それらを保存して置けます。ユーザーがページ上レイアウトを変更維持保存できるような、ログインシステム不要でクッキーに記憶させておく事などもできます。 2.前述の様にクッキーを使って何らかの情報保存をさせるような仕組みがある場合、それが使えないので毎回初回訪問者としてのあつかいになりますね。これで不自由があるのか?は微妙です。サイト側の都合やシステムなので、それをユーザーが便利と思うのであれば使わない事はデメリットともいえます。 3.一般的に複数回あるのはぺそのページがPHPなどのプログラムで表示されていて表示中の処理の中で必要な所で、呼び出されているのではないかと思います。またサードパーティのクッキーとしてバナー広告や情報解析ツールやカウンター(特に別URLを持つレンタルの物)、などのクッキーなども結構ありますね。 多いのは仕方ない事です。 例えばコンビニやスーパー等でもレジ自体がコンピューターで本部と繋がっていますので、年齢、性別、買った商品、など買い物をした時点で大量の情報がリアルタイムで本部に送られています。また視聴率を割り出す機械等とも似たような物かもしれません。 こういったデータは企業にとって宝ですからね。
その他の回答 (1)
- Dumper
- ベストアンサー率28% (24/84)
1の追加質問ですが私は今最前線じゃないので具体的にユーザーに気づかれずに勝手に保存できるかどうか、詳細まではわかりません。 ただ、文字確定してフォームに入った文字列はJavaScriptで取れます。 それがそのままサーバーの方にセッションなどで保存できるかどうかはわかりませんが、送信ボタンなどを押してプログラムに送信した時に同時に送る事は昔から可能です。 この場合はクッキーを防げば大丈夫と言う話では無いと思います。 信頼の置けないサイトでは何もしないで去る方が良いでしょうね。 というか、フォームでユーザー辞書? 普通に使えますよね。 ( ̄□ ̄;; ← これ登録文字です。 詳しい事までわかりませんですみません(^^;
お礼
なるほど、、JavaScriptでしたか。 JavaScriptも対策を講じてあるので、心配はなさそうですね^^ ありがとうございました。 ユーザー辞書の件ですが、調べてみたところ Windows Vista のみの問題のようです(参考までにmicrosoftのURLを下記しておきます)。 間違った情報を書いてしまい、申し訳ありませんでした…;; http://support.microsoft.com/kb/931482/JA/
お礼
早速の回答ありがとうございます。 初回訪問者としての扱いになるだけなら、偶然立ち寄ったサイトでは保存しなくても大丈夫なんですね。 クッキーを許可しないと表示されないサイトがあるかもしれないと思い、今まで一見サイトでもサーバーの名前で判断・許可していたので、、ぐっと絞り込めそうです^^
補足
質問1について追加の質問をさせてください。 IE7で通常のユーザー辞書が使えないのは、例え送信等しなくても「実際に打った文字」と「変換された文字」の情報がサーバー側?で分かってしまうから、それを防ぐため、と聞いたのですが、それもクッキーが関わっているのでしょうか? ↑の説明で分かりにくいようでしたら、以下の説明を読んでください。 例えば、「めーる」という読みで「ex@ex.co.jp」というメールアドレスを登録してある場合、どこかのフォームで「メール」と打とうとし、誤って前記したアドレスで変換完了してしまった時、そのフォームを送信しなくても(すぐに「メール」と間違いを修正して送信しても)「めーる」→「ex@ex.co.jp」という情報が他人に知られてしまう。 と、いうことです。もし分かりにくかったら言ってもらえると助かります…>< 引き続きよろしくお願いします。